Output 76b6093ea02f5b3c33ddfa5c8992f7f4fc4a225858f1a0cd0f64d8098a9c8d96:19

value
256020
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 cd21a6d7cb1565dbb1bb3b7ac7ca96402194ff92 OP_EQUALVERIFY OP_CHECKSIG
address
1KhdqVL8KNWJvxsQo55iUwakY7jvSVM3Lr
transaction
76b6093ea02f5b3c33ddfa5c8992f7f4fc4a225858f1a0cd0f64d8098a9c8d96
confirmations
393290
spent
true